What is Cabergoline?

Cabergoline is a medication used primarily for managing certain hormonal conditions. It works by affecting the levels of prolactin, a hormone that plays a role in various bodily functions. This medication is available in oral form and is commonly prescribed for its therapeutic effects.

What is Cabergoline used for?

Cabergoline is typically used to treat conditions related to high prolactin levels in the body. These conditions may include certain types of tumors or hormonal imbalances. The medication helps to regulate prolactin levels, which can alleviate symptoms associated with these conditions. What are the side effects of Cabergoline?

Common effects of cabergoline may include dizziness, nausea, and headaches. Some individuals might experience digestive issues or fatigue. These effects can vary from person to person and are generally mild. It's important to note that not everyone will experience these effects, and they often subside as the body adjusts to the medication.

What precautions apply to Cabergoline?

Cabergoline should be handled with care, especially for individuals with certain heart conditions or a history of low blood pressure. It is advisable to consult a healthcare provider before starting this medication.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should also seek medical advice before using cabergoline. What does Cabergoline interact with?

Cabergoline may interact with other medications, particularly those that affect blood pressure or heart rate. Alcohol and certain dietary supplements can also influence its effects. It's important to inform your healthcare provider about all medications and supplements you are taking to avoid potential interactions.
